James M.
Wolfe
June 4, 1919 – September 27, 2015
James M. Wolfe Ripley, West Virginia: There will be funeral services on Thursday, October 1, 2015 at 11:30 a.m. at Lake Park Cemetery Chapel, 1459 East Midlothian Boulevard, Youngstown for James M. Wolfe, 96, who died Sunday morning, September 27, 2015 at his residence. Jim was born June 4, 1919 in Pomeroy, Ohio, the son of the late Anthony and Anna (Smith) Wolfe. He graduated from Chaney High School in Youngstown. Jim was a World War II Navy veteran. After serving in the Navy, Jim worked as a machinist at Machine Shop 1 at Youngstown Sheet & Tube, for over 30 years before retiring. Jim is survived by his daughter Karen (Richard) Bailey of Kenna, West Virginia, 10 grandchildren, 12 great grandchildren and 8 great great grandchildren. Besides his parents, Jim was preceded in death by his wife of 60 years, the former Betty Hogue whom he married in 1940 and died in 2000; three children, Judith Rodgers, Timothy Wolfe and Michael Wolfe; a brother Merle Wolfe; and a sister, Helen Duncan.
